WebJan 28, 2024 · When we look into the more severe cases of COVID-19, the positive impact of full vaccination is also clear. In a New South Wales (Australia) report from 2024, out of 10,099 hospitalisations for COVID-19, just 611 cases (6 per cent) involved fully vaccinated people.
